I am starting to wonder if we should have an umbrella package that would take the place of system-perl588 on x86_64 fink 10.5 by making sure that all of the perlmods provided by Apple were provided via the matching fink packages. I think the core developers need to get much stricter about perlmod packages always being tested with -m since there seem to be a lot of hidden issues that option exposes.
